A countdown timer visually indicates how much time is left on a promotion, tapping into customers’ fear of missing out (FOMO) and encouraging them to complete their purchase sooner. Here are some primary advantages of using a countdown timer on your Shopify store.

Countdown timers create a clear deadline for your customers. This added pressure can push customers to make purchasing decisions quicker to avoid missing out, reducing the time spent deliberating.
Displaying a countdown timer on the cart or checkout page can remind customers of the limited nature of an offer, helping to prevent them from leaving items in their cart and delaying the purchase.
Countdown timers visually communicate that something unique or limited is happening, which can build excitement and anticipation, especially for flash sales or new product drops.

Adding timers for weekly or seasonal sales or events encourages customers to return, ultimately increasing customer lifetime value and engagement with your store.

Add a Countdown Timer to your store with Theme Sections or the Empire, Editions, or Atlantic theme.
In your Apps admin, open Theme Updater & Backups. Open the Theme sections page, then select Countdown timer.
Use the Choose theme dropdown to select your theme, then click Install.

Once the success message pops up, click Customize to open the theme editor.
Open the template that will feature the timer. We recommend the home page, product page, or cart page (even better, all three!).
Click + Add section, then select đź§°Â Countdown timer.
